Cruise Along the Chicago River

Enjoy a relaxing and scenic cruise, admiring the city's iconic architecture from a unique perspective. Choose from various tour options, including sightseeing and dinner cruises.

Indulge in Chicago-Style Deep Dish Pizza

Savor the iconic Chicago-style deep dish pizza, known for its thick crust, generous toppings, and gooey cheese. Visit some of the city's renowned pizzerias, like Lou Malnati's or Giordano's.
